About Drug Crime Law in Owerri, Nigeria

Drug crime refers to the illegal possession, manufacturing, trafficking, sale, or distribution of drugs in Owerri, Nigeria. The laws surrounding drug crime aim to regulate and prevent the misuse and abuse of controlled substances. Violating drug crime laws in Owerri can lead to severe legal consequences, including imprisonment and fines.

Local Laws Overview

In Owerri, Nigeria, drug crime laws are primarily governed by the National Drug Law Enforcement Agency (NDLEA) Act, which prohibits the cultivation, production, possession, trafficking, and use of illicit drugs.

Key aspects of local laws relevant to drug crime in Owerri include:

  • The categorization of drugs into different schedules based on their harmfulness and potential for abuse
  • Penalties and sentences for drug-related offenses, which can range from fines to imprisonment, depending on the seriousness of the crime
  • Special provisions for drug trafficking, including the use of minors in drug-related activities
  • The establishment of the NDLEA to enforce drug laws, investigate drug-related crimes, and prosecute offenders

Frequently Asked Questions

1. What drugs are considered illegal in Owerri, Nigeria?

In Owerri, Nigeria, all drugs listed in the schedules of the NDLEA Act are considered illegal. This includes substances like cannabis, cocaine, heroin, methamphetamine, ecstasy, and others.

2. What are the penalties for drug-related offenses in Owerri?

The penalties for drug-related offenses in Owerri vary depending on the nature and quantity of the drugs involved. Offenders can face imprisonment ranging from a few years to life sentences, along with hefty fines.

3. Can I be arrested for drug possession if the drugs were not found on my person?

Yes, you can still be arrested for drug possession if the drugs are found in your home, vehicle, or any property under your control. Constructive possession is enough to establish guilt in drug crime cases.

4. Can I get legal assistance if I cannot afford a lawyer?

If you cannot afford a lawyer, you may be eligible for legal aid services provided by the Legal Aid Council of Nigeria. They offer support and representation to individuals who meet the eligibility criteria.

5. Should I cooperate with the authorities if I am arrested for a drug crime?

It is advisable to exercise your right to remain silent and consult with a lawyer before providing any information to the authorities. A lawyer can guide you on the best course of action based on your specific circumstances.
